Elevate Your Experience: The Art of Choosing the Right Wine Glass
A well-chosen wine glass can dramatically amplify your tasting experience. It's not just about aesthetics; the shape and size of a glass directly influence how aromas are released and flavors interact on your palate. Consider the type of wine you'll be indulging in. A full-bodied red, for example, benefits from a larger bowl to allow for proper aeration, while a crisp white wine is best enjoyed in a narrower glass that concentrates its aromas.
- Select a stemmed glass for optimal swirling and temperature control.
- Pay attention to the glass's rim - a thinner rim can concentrate or diffuse aromas depending on your preference.
- Experiment different shapes and sizes to find what best complements your favorite wines.

Embark on a Journey: Your Guide to Wine Tasting
Dive into the captivating world of wine with our comprehensive guide. Every sip offers a unique tapestry of flavors, aromas, and sensations, waiting to be explored. Whether you're a seasoned connoisseur or a curious wine and spirits beginner, this journey will ignite your appreciation for the art of wine tasting.
Embark by selecting a variety of wines with distinct characteristics. Red, white, sweet: each style offers its own distinct profile to tantalize your palate.
Consider the following aspects to guide your tasting experience:
* **Sight:** Observe the wine's color and clarity. What hue does it possess?
* **Smell:** Inhale deeply, noticing the bouquet of aromas. Do you detect a combination of berries, citrus, and herbs?
* **Taste:** Take a small sip, allowing the wine to dance across your tongue. Pay attention to its body, acidity, tannins, and finish. Pinpoint the dominant flavors and lingering sensations.
